Cycling sisters Kerry and Kirsty MacPhee from South Uist take to social media to find out the nation's favourite cycle routes. In this episode, they are in Strath Nairn south east of Loch Ness exploring the areas lochs with Raghnaid Sandilands, a self-confessed map boffin, who began using her bike to explore the places she sees whilE researching maps and place names of the area. They start their cycle in Farr and head straight for a community project Raghnaid has been involved in where they are growing their own fruit and vegetables. Continuing on to Loch Duntelchaig, Raghnaid explains her theory why this is where her and her children believe the real Nessie lives. The cyclists plough on to Loch Ashie, with its own stories of sightings of a ghostly battling Norse warrior and Fionn.
